When did you start training and why?&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t; &lt;p&gt;&lt;span style="font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"&gt;RB: “I started learning and practicing when I was 5 years old. My dad is a 1988 Olympian and he as well as his brothers have been the reigning champions in the South Pacific and Oceania since they were 15. Judo has always run in my family. There are 4 Olympians in our family my dad, my cousin Derrick Anderson, my cousin Mariano Aquino, and myself. In the beginning I was forced to do Judo. I hated it! All I wanted to do was play and well I was a kid so not much else mattered to me and Judo was hard work especially back in those days when my dad was teaching us. There were no excuses and no breaks. I eventually grew to love it though. Especially at first, because it helped my gain a foothold in making friends coming into middle school and high school. I never used to be as social as I am now. I was probably the shyest person anyone would have met. I was a very passive kid. So since then I paid more&lt;br&gt; attention in class and started to want to develop my skills on the mat. This made my dad happy so he started sending me to training camps in Japan and Hawaii which helped me become stronger every year. I started competing internationally when I was 13. Winning medals in Japan and eventually going to high school in Southern Japan just for judo. After spending a year and a half in Japan it changed my Judo&lt;br&gt; career forever. I was winning world level competitions and winning is very addicting!”&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font color="#ff0000"&gt;&lt;span style="font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"&gt;J4F: What’s next for you Ric, what can your fans and fellow islanders expect to see from you in the future?&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;span style="font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"&gt;&lt;span&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/span&gt;RB: “The future is never set in stone. Sh-Shoot!!&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 18px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Respectfully,&lt;br&gt;"Tyrtl"&lt;/font&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content></entry><entry><title>UFC 134 Results</title><link rel="alternate" href="http://just4fununlimited.com/2011/08/27/ufc-134-results.aspx?ref=rss" /><id>tag:www.just4fununlimited.com,2011-08-27:01cb766c-9638-401b-b996-bfca2aec5239</id><author><name>Tyrtl</name></author><category term="News" /><updated>2011-08-28T04:05:23Z</updated><published>2011-08-28T04:05:23Z</published><content type="html">&lt;div align="center"&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;"&gt;&lt;img src="http://images.quickblogcast.com/4/2/0/0/4/249622-240024/UFC_134_Silva_vs_Okami.jpg?a=35" style="border: 0px solid;"&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 14px;"&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;div align="left"&gt;&lt;p style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al;"&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 14px;"&gt;&lt;span style="font-size: 12pt;"&gt;&lt;span&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/span&gt;In the main event of a sold-out UFC 134 event, UFC middleweight champion Anderson Silva extended his record for consecutive title defenses to nine with an all-too-easy TKO win over Yushin Okami.&lt;br&gt; The bout headlined the pay-per-view portion of UFC 134, which took place Saturday at HSBC Arena in Rio de Janeiro. The event, which also featured prelims on Facebook and Spike TV, was the UFC's first in Brazil since 1998. &lt;br&gt; The bout concluded a successful night for Brazilian fighters, who went 7-1 when facing competitors from other countries.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 14px;"&gt; &lt;/font&gt;&lt;p style="marg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al;"&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 14px;"&gt;&lt;span style="font-size: 12pt;"&gt;&lt;br&gt; The first round of the night's championship headliner opened with little action as Silva circled his opponent and figured out his timing. But a few minutes in, Silva threw some lunging punches, though he still seemed to be fishing for information. Ultimately, though, Okami got the clinch and put Silva against the cage, but he couldn't get the takedown. The fighters then traded some jabs, and Okami was too slow to check a head kick, but the round ended without a clear winner.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; In the second round, Silva was ready to engage. He unloaded a quick barrage of punches and low kicks, though Okami initially was up for the firefight. Silva, though, then dropped his hands and seemingly taunted Okami, only to then drop the Japanese fighter with a straight right. Okami was quickly back up, but Silva again dropped him moments later with another quick punch and then stood over him and delivered a steady stream of punches and elbows as Okami covered up.&lt;br&gt; With Okami unable to fight back as instructed, the TKO stoppage came soon after, at the 2:04 mark of the second round.&lt;br&gt; With the arena showering him with cheers, Silva was mostly tongue-tied in his post-fight interview.&lt;br&gt; "I'm so happy bro," Silva told broadcaster Kenny Florian. "I'm sorry."&lt;br&gt; So who's next for the UFC's unbeatable champ?&lt;br&gt; "My clone," Silva joked.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; Silva (29-4 MMA, 14-0 UFC) now has won 15 straight fights and avenges his most recent loss: a disqualification defeat to Okami (26-6 MMA, 10-3 UFC) at a 2006 Rumble on the Rock show.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; &lt;b&gt;"Shogun" gets revenge; KOs Griffin&lt;/b&gt;&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; UFC 134's co-headliner had all types of subplots. Brazilian vs American. Ex-champ vs. ex-champ. A rematch four years in the making. &l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; Ultimately, though, Brazilian star Mauricio "Shogun" Rua avenged a loss in his 2007 UFC debut and scored an impressive first-round TKO victory over Forrest Griffin.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; After a brief feeling-out process, a confident Rua closed the distance and unloaded a right that caught Griffin flush. Initially, Griffin kept swinging, but the effects of the blow finally caught up to his legs, and he fumbled to the mat. Once there, Rua unloaded a dizzying assault of hammerfists that forced Griffin's eyes to roll to the back of his head. The ref halted the bout soon after.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; The KO stoppage came at the 1:53 mark of the opening round.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; "Forrest is a good fighter," said Rua, who suffered submission defeat to Griffin back at UFC 76. "But I trained hard for three months."&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; Rua (20-5 MMA, 4-3 UFC) fought for the first time since his March title loss to Jon Jones and proves his top-contender status..&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; Griffin (18-7 MMA, 9-5 UFC), who had gotten back into contention with wins over ex-champs Tito Ortiz and Forrest Griffin, now heads back to the drawing board.&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t; MAIN CARD&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 14px;"&gt; &lt;/font&gt;&lt;ul type="disc"&gt;&lt;li style="line-height: normal;"&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 14px;"&gt;&lt;span style="font-size: 12pt;"&gt;Champ Anderson Silva def. &l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Shawn Tompkins, a mixed martial arts trainer known for guiding the careers
of several accomplished fighters, passed away Sunday in Canada. The cause of
his death is unknown. Tompkins was 37 years old.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Tompkins is survived by his wife, Emilie, who confirmed her husband's death
late Sunday night.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;"Unfortunately I'm in Las Vegas and he's in Canada," she said.
"I'm hearing through my family and his family that he didn't wake up this
morning. They're going to do an autopsy tomorrow, so we don't know any of the
actual details. But from what we do know, he passed away in his sleep."&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Tompkins was known for molding young fighters like Sam Stout, Mark Hominick
and Chris Horodecki into crisp, technical strikers. He started with Stout when
the lightweight was just 16. Stout became Tompkins' brother-in-law after the
trainer married Emilie. The couple moved to Las Vegas from London, Ontario,
Canada, in 2007.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Tompkins' mentor Bas Rutten, a former UFC heavyweight champion, told
ESPN.com he spoke to his friend on Saturday evening.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;"Shawn is one of my best friends, one of the best if not the best
striking coaches on the planet, and I mean this," said Rutten, who made
the blond-haired Canadian the head coach of an International Fight League team
in 2007. "He always put his students and friends before him, would do
anything for them."&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;"He texted me late last night, telling me he loved me," Rutten
said, "so thank God I called him to tell him it was mutual."&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Beyond Tompkins' roll as a trainer, he established an almost paternal roll
with many of his fighters and was fond of calling them "son." After
relocating to Las Vegas, Tompkins settled at Xtreme Couture until he moved on
to become head coach at the TapouT Research and Development Training Center in
2009.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Earlier this year, Tompkins ran Hominick's corner during a UFC featherweight
championship fight in Toronto. This was the closest Tompkins came to earning
his stripes as a UFC championship trainer. Hominick fought valiantly but
dropped the fight on points to Jose Aldo.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Tompkins fought before excelling as a trainer, losing each of his four bouts
in the Montreal-based promotion UCC.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Tompkins was in Canada to help prepare Horodecki for his next bout on Sept.
10.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;The trainer's remains were moved to University Hospital in London, Ontario.
No funeral plans have been set, said Emilie Tompkins. She will travel to Canada
on Monday.&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;/font&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;"Obviously I think he was an amazing man," Emilie said, "and
I hope everyone shares their good stories about him."&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Source: &lt;a href="http://espn.go.com/mma/story/_/id/6862539/canadian-mma-trainer-shawn-tompkins-dies-age-37" target="_blank" class=""&gt;ESPN&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;Respectfully,&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;font style="font-size: 16px;" face="Georgia"&gt;"tyrtl"&lt;br&gt;&lt;/font&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;font face="Georgia"&gt;

&lt;p&gt;A very sad for our country. 31 members of our country’s best were killed
last night after they had assaulted a Taliban stronghold. It’s the single
biggest loss of life, in one incident, in the 10 years we have been in
Afghanistan. &lt;br&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p align="center"&gt;&lt;img src="http://images.quickblogcast.com/4/2/0/0/4/249622-240024/NavySealsDEVGRUDesign1.jpg?a=96" style="border: 0px solid;"&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;In the deadliest day for American forces in the nearly decade-long war in
Afghanistan, insurgents shot down a Chinook transport helicopter on Saturday,
killing 31 Americans and 7 Afghan commandos on board, American and Afghan
officials said. American officials said later Saturday that 22 of the dead were
members of a Navy SEAL unit, along with other American servicemembers and the Afghan
unit. The helicopter was hit by a rocket-propelled grenade in the Tangi Valley
of Wardak Province to the west of Kabul, one coalition official said, though
others said the exact weapon remained in question.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The Taliban claimed responsibility for the attack, which punctuated a surge
of violence across the country, even as American and NATO forces begin a modest
drawdown of troops. It occurred after a night raid, a tool that has been
praised by American commanders as one of the most effective in the recent
military offensive, though the raids have been heavily criticized by Afghan
officials and civilians.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;…There were conflicting accounts about when the helicopter went down. A
spokesman for the Taliban, Zabiullah Mujahid, said insurgents shot down the helicopter
around 11 p.m. Friday as it was starting an operation on a house where the
militants were gathering in the Tangi Joyee region of the district of Saidabad
in the eastern part of the province. Eight militants were killed in the fight,
which continued after the helicopter fell, Mr. Mujahid said…&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Gen. Abdul Qayum Baqizoy, police chief of Wardak, said the operation began
around 1 a.m. Saturday as NATO and Afghan forces attacked a Taliban compound in
Jaw-e-mekh Zareen village in the Tangi Valley. The firefight lasted at least
two hours, the general said.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It appears that the Seal unit involved was Seal Team Six. The same unit that
took down bin-Laden.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;U.S. officials tell The Associated Press that they believe that none of the
Navy SEALs who died in a helicopter crash in Afghanistan had participated in
the raid that killed Osama bin Laden, although they were from the same unit
that carried out the bin Laden mission.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Sources say that more than 20 Navy SEALs were among those lost in the crash
in Afghanistan.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The operators from SEAL Team Six were flown by a regular Army crew. That’s
according to AP military sources.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Another source says the team was thought to include 22 SEALs, three Air
Force air controllers, seven Afghan Army troops, a dog and his handler, and a
civilian interpreter, plus the helicopter crew.&lt;/p&gt;
